- Most of the pages have artworks the we know from the well known post-2007 series - Environments, Archives, EBS mixes - and most of them are a different cut of the artwork. And some pages have hints of stuff that didn't got released and/or will come.
- Page 10 has teasers that EBS 7 had proper booklet ready, and yet somehow we ended up with the most plain cover for that one. Also, 2" Tape Reels teaser once again -- this is still around, it probably will be released.
- Page 14 has cool recent picture of the guys, which I think should end up replacing the top picture on this very Board
- Page 21 is also full of teasers but mostly stuff that were prepped and then not released and then ended up on other releases. The left bunch of CDs are all promos that got released one way or another (except the video collection one -- we still live and hope to see the day when FSOL release a video that is not promo) - The mid section is weird, the top left CD with a young Gaz pic - no idea what that is. The top-right side is the Mello Hippo Disco Show soundtrack that ended up on FSOLDigital in a digital form only.
- At the bottom is the
Rephlex test print of Zeebox on a 3" CD (so besides the 12" there was also a small 3" print).
- The
FISH SMOKIN' is the weirdest - it's actually a prequel of the Archives, a project started circa 2000 - some of it ended up on the Otherness, and the rest of it ended up on the Archives. - This actually says that the story about the 'Teachings' compilation in 2006 kickstarted the Archives is actually wrong (and I kinda never believed it anyway...)
